DAY 8
Changing our thought life is tough. Yet to truly be All-In we must transform our minds from the established pattern prior to our commitment to an All-In attitude. To accomplish this we must ask ourselves, “What are primary influences in your life?”
What have I been watching, listening to and reading on a consistent basis? What images have been imputed into my mind as a direct result of my investment of time to those sources? Are they wholesome (holy)? All-In requires you and I to invest in positive things. The primary investment would be in reading and studying the scriptures. Are you investing quality daily time in the Word of God? Do you know what Romans 12:1-2 states about being All-In.
